  • Patent number: 11522959
    Abstract: The present disclosure describes systems and methods for remote management of appliances. The appliance may be configured to periodically check in a predetermined online location for the presence of a trigger file identifying one or more appliances directed to contact a management server for maintenance. If the file is present at the predetermined location and the file includes the identifier of the appliance, the appliance may initiate a connection to the management server. If the file is not found, then the appliance may reset a call timer and attempt to retrieve the file at a later time. To avoid having to configure addresses on the appliance, link local IPv6 addresses may be configured for use over a virtual private network, allowing administration, regardless of the network configuration or local IP address of the appliance.

    Abstract: An image reading is executed to only specific originals among plural originals. An original information detecting part detects original information on each original based on the result of prescanning. A judging part, based on copying conditions set by a user, judges whether the original information meets the copying conditions or not and determines the necessity of copying accordingly. An operation control part controls respective constitutions based on the result of judging of necessity. According to this device, for example, only color originals can be copied or only originals having a specific size can be copied. Furthermore, only originals present between colored partition papers can be copied.

  • Patent number: 5768652
    Abstract: A method of controlling an electrophotographic imaging process wherein a two-component developer is mixed and activated to obtain a uniform distribution and triboelectric charging of the toner, by interruption of the process and carrying out extra activation and mixing cycles as a function of image area coverage and/or distribution of the image over the image field.

  • Patent number: 5697015
    Abstract: Method and apparatus are provided for inhibiting toner transfer defects, and in particular, to inhibit over-transfer of electrical charge through a transfer medium to a toner after development of a latent image on a photoconductor in an electrophotographic imaging device. Toner transfer defects are inhibited near the leading edge of a print medium by a method which includes the step of providing a controlled ramped voltage output to a transfer member so as to provide a controlled flow of charge from the transfer member to the transfer medium during an initial application of electrical charge to a first region of the transfer medium adjacent a leading edge of the transfer medium.
